Use Microsoft OneDrive for Canvas at IU assignments
Overview
The OneDrive integration with Canvas includes a suite of tools developed by Microsoft that provides integration between OneDrive and learning management systems like Canvas. In Canvas at IU, OneDrive files can be used in several places: Assignments, Modules, Collaborations, and embedded within the Rich Content Editor. The OneDrive integration is available in all Canvas courses.
Create a OneDrive cloud assignment
Cloud assignments are templated assignments. The instructor creates the template document (for example, a Word document with questions for the students to answer, or an Excel spreadsheet where students will manipulate data), and each student gets their own copy of the document that they can edit and submit. When students submit the assignment, their own copy gets submitted and is available to the educator in the SpeedGrader for assessment.
OneDrive allows you to use Office files (Word, Excel, PowerPoint) to provide assignment instructions to students or assignment templates for students to edit and submit.

Create a templateless assignment
This type of assignment allows students to upload any file from their OneDrive account to submit for the assignment. Students are only able to upload Word, Excel and PowerPoint files.

Collaborate using OneDrive
Collaborations allow students to work collaboratively on a given document. Students and educators can start a collaboration. The document under collaboration remains accessible to instructors even if the instructor is not added to the collaboration.
